CaseChat Overview and Summary

This matter concerned an application for a Regional Employer Nomination (Permanent) (Class RN) visa, Subclass 187 (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me), Direct Entry stream, for the position of Retail Manager (General). The applicant, Ms Kaur, had her visa application remitted for reconsideration by the Tribunal.

The primary legal issue before the Tribunal was whether the applicant met the requirements of clause 187.233 of Schedule 2 to the Regulations, specifically concerning the approval of the nomination for the position. The Tribunal also considered the application of a second applicant, a family member, whose eligibility was contingent on the primary applicant being granted a Subclass 187 visa.

The Tribunal reasoned that the nomination made by Norwest Petroleum Pty Ltd T/A Shell Brewarrina for the Retail Manager position had been approved by the Tribunal on 22 September 2020, setting aside the Department’s earlier refusal. As this approval meant the applicant met the requirements of clause 187.233(3), the Tribunal determined that the appropriate course was to remit the visa application to the Minister for consideration of the remaining criteria. Regarding the second applicant, the Tribunal noted that as the primary applicant did not hold a Subclass 187 visa at the time of the decision, the requirements of clause 187.311 could not be directed as met. However, the Tribunal referred the second applicant's applications to the Department for fresh consideration.
